#7f5d5b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f5d5b is composed of 49.8% red, 36.5%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.8% magenta, 28.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.5% and a lightness of 42.7%. #7f5d5b color hex could be obtained by blending #febab6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#7f5d5b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f5d5b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c6c is the less saturated color, while #d31207 is the most saturated one.
